Materials and Durability: How Does It Hold Up?
Now,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. A lot of people worry about keeping a white interior clean. I get it! But Tesla's vegan leather is surprisingly durable and easy to maintain. It’s designed to withstand the wear and tear of daily use, resisting stains and scratches better than you might think. Of course, that doesn't mean it's invincible. Spills happen, kids are messy, and life throws curveballs. But with a little regular care, you can keep your white interior looking fresh for years to come. Think of it like owning a nice white couch – you wouldn't let stains sit for weeks, right? Same principle applies here.
The vegan leather used in the Tesla Model 3 is engineered for longevity. It’s resistant to UV damage, which means it won't fade or crack easily under prolonged exposure to sunlight. This is a crucial factor, especially if you live in a sunny climate. The material is also designed to be resistant to common stains from food, drinks, and even things like makeup or ink. However, the key to maintaining its pristine appearance is prompt action. Addressing spills and stains as soon as they occur will prevent them from setting into the material. Regular cleaning with a gentle, non-abrasive cleaner is also recommended to remove dirt and grime that accumulate over time. This simple routine will help preserve the material's integrity and keep it looking as good as new.

Cleaning and Maintenance: Tips and Tricks
Alright, let's talk cleaning. Keeping your white Tesla interior sparkling doesn't have to be a chore. Here’s the lowdown:
Beyond these practical tips, it's important to develop a consistent cleaning routine. A quick wipe-down once a week can prevent dirt and grime from building up, making the cleaning process much easier in the long run. Pay special attention to high-touch areas such as the steering wheel, door handles, and center console. These areas tend to accumulate more dirt and oils from your hands. Using a microfiber cloth can help lift dirt without scratching the surface. For stubborn stains, consider using a soft-bristled brush to gently scrub the affected area. However, always test the cleaner in an inconspicuous area first to ensure it doesn't damage or discolor the material.
Moreover, be mindful of the products you use. Avoid using harsh chemicals, bleach, or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the vegan leather and cause discoloration. Opt for pH-neutral cleaners that are specifically designed for delicate surfaces. When applying cleaner, use a spray bottle to mist the surface rather than pouring it directly onto the material. This will help prevent oversaturation and ensure even distribution. After cleaning, use a clean, dry cloth to wipe away any excess moisture.
